The Desktop Metal Studio System with metal 3D printer, debinding station and furnace. The first metal 3D printing system from Desktop Metal is FFF/FDM based and also includes a debinder and sintering furnace. According to the company it is 10 times less expensive than existing technology today. Formlabs’ library of versatile, reliable Engineering Resins is formulated to help product designers and manufacturers reduce costs, iterate faster, and bring better experiences to market. They recently announced the addition of two new materials for the Form 2: Grey Pro Resin for Versatile Prototyping and Rigid Resin. Progress in 3D authentication and identification brings 3D manufacturing closer Multi-jet-fusion printed part on the left and a high-resolution scan of the indicated portion of it on the right showing the micro surface structure used for authentication. An HP Labs investigation into accurately identifying and authenticating 3D-printed objects is helping enable a future where parts for high performance machines like jet engines are routinely printed to order.
